JPMorgan balks at legal tab for fraudsters and says Javice’s lawyers treat it ‘like a blank check’
For nearly three years, JPMorgan Chase has picking up the legal tab of Charlie Javice and Olivier Amar, the two convicted fraudsters who sold their financial aid startup Frank to the bank.
